Athens, Greece - Early this morning an anarchist "gang of conscience" (symmories syneidisis) known as "Floga" (Flame) claimed responsibility for a frontal arson attack on the Police Station of Aigaleo (Athens) and vowed to carry out additional actions. Five marked patrol cars and two undercover police cars were destroyed by the groups molotov cocktails and gas canisters.

Authorities estimated that the assault was carried out by approximately 15 individuals who reached the area on motorbikes and then parked a short distance away. A guard fired three warning shots in the air in an attempt to disperse the anarchists who say they were not intimidated and left on their own accord at an agreed time. A communique was promptly issued by the group that claimed the action was designed to target, "the existence of police itself."
